CALL TO WORSHIPLEADER: A community of faith conveys God's good news of love and leads its members along pathways of faith.
PEOPLE: It sows seeds of life in the soil of our hearts, causing faith and hope to sprout in our souls.
LEADER: This congregation has been a vehicle of God's grace, shining God's marvelous light across the years;
PEOPLE: A place for growing in relationship with the Lord; for living, loving, and forgiving in the spirit of Christ.
LEADER: We celebrate the many members of this family of faith who have walked with the Lord through their years.
PEOPLE: We remember how they have blessed us so richly, conveying God's gift of love from their hearts to our hearts.
LEADER: We celebrate the gift we are to one another, as we learn and grow along this spiritual journey.
PEOPLE: We give thanks for the togetherness we feel with one another;
sharing in all of life's joys and sorrows, its celebrations and challenges.
LEADER: It is a day of great joy in the life of this congregation, as we celebrate the many lives it has already touched.
PEOPLE: We give thanks for the body of Christ that we are today
and for what God will inspire us to become tomorrow. Amen.

LEADER: Almighty God, you have called us into fellowship as the Church of Jesus Christ in this place. You strengthen us and inspire us with your Holy Spirit to live lives of mutual love and service in the world. For all this, we give our heartfelt thanks and praise.
PEOPLE: We give you thanks, O Lord.
LEADER: For those who lead and those who follow; for committees and boards and teams:
PEOPLE: We give you thanks, O Lord.
LEADER: For ushers and greeters, for lay leaders and readers, for acolytes and servers, for musicians and choirs:
PEOPLE: We give you thanks, O Lord.
LEADER: For cleaners and dusters, for maintainers and fixers, for those who cook and those who eat:
PEOPLE: We give you thanks, O Lord.
LEADER: For administrators and helpers, for counters and record keepers:
PEOPLE: We give you thanks, O Lord.
LEADER: For those who give and those who pray; for those who send cards and those who visit; for those who knit and those who quilt; for those who plan and those who guide; for those with wisdom and those with inspiration:
PEOPLE: We give you thanks, O Lord.
LEADER: For our past and for our future:
PEOPLE: We give you thanks, O Lord.
LEADER: Bind us to your love, and through that love, to one another, for the sake of the gospel:
PEOPLE: We dedicate our lives to your service.
LEADER: Make us cheerful givers and faithful workers for your kingdom:
PEOPLE: We dedicate our lives to your service.
All: Make us one in the body of Christ that we may acknowledge with gratefulness the importance of all our members and all our gifts for the mission that you give us. We dedicate our lives to your service.
